MIPS: Get rid of 'kgdb_early_setup' cruft.

Commit 854700115ecf ([MIPS] kgdb: add arch support for the kernel's kgdb core)
added the 'kgdb_early_setup' flag to avoid  calling trap_init() and init_IRQ()
the second time, however the code that called these functions earlier,  from
kgdb_arch_init(), had been already removed by that  time,  so the flag never
served any useful purpose. Remove the related code along with ugly #ifdef'ery
at last.
